HDD drilling fluid recycling unit
Our HDD drilling fluid recycling unit is developed for recycling bentonite drilling fluids in horizontal and vertical directional drilling projects. The system operates completely without screens and uses sedimentation and controlled flow to separate solids from the drilling fluid.
The goal of the system is to achieve a high separation performance with less than 1% residual sand, with a target value of 0.2% to 0.4%. In addition, it supports a circular and sustainable approach within the HDD industry and can be integrated into existing site logistics.
The installation has a fixed capacity of 2500 liters per minute and is built inside a 40 m³ container. This makes the system easy to transport with hooklift or cable systems and directly deployable on existing drilling sites.
The system processes contaminated bentonite with approximately 20% sand content. Heavier particles settle through controlled flow and sufficient retention time, while the bentonite fraction remains in suspension and is reused. The settled sand is continuously removed via a transport auger.
The system is built in a robust steel construction with minimal wear components. The transport auger is the only major wear part, with a service life of at least 5 years.
